Output 23c26917416e451d30ad549873453c3598afc34a4f7495678575a01e25acb144:0

value
18908686
script pubkey
OP_0 OP_PUSHBYTES_32 bdc6fea59a1c85ee519f570f3b4dbe4d9f5324c416e457d69d1ab4d992640737
address
bc1qhhr0afv6rjz7u5vl2u8nknd7fk04xfxyzmj9045ar26dnynyqumskjq6f8
transaction
23c26917416e451d30ad549873453c3598afc34a4f7495678575a01e25acb144
spent
true